Market Tone & YOUR Profitability as a Trader

David Mitchell • July 26, 2021

I want to tell you a story. A stock trading story (my favorite).


Let’s go back in time...


In the fall of 2020, the market had been in a bull market uptrend for at least three or four months, and a general bull market for years (basically ever since Donald Trump was elected).


It was the longest bull market we’ve seen in history.


It was like a fairytale.


And the market was still in this bull market, but…


It was having little corrections. 


And one of those corrections started around September 3, 2020.


Now, during a correction, you don’t really want to be jumping into an up-play. So it’s super important to know when these corrections are happening so you don’t hurt your trades.


And how do you know if you’re about to go into a correction?


By watching the world events and the economic events of the day, and thinking carefully about what those events might be causing to happen in the stock market.


Because news actually drives the markets. So you want to get in sync with that news and what the whole market is doing. And you want to keep that in mind when you do your play with your individual stocks.


We call this market tone.
